BACKGROUND
The Legal Deposit Advisory Panel (LDAP) is a 
Non-Departmental Public Body (NDPB).  An NDPB is 
a body with a role in the process of national 
Government which is not a Government department 
or part of one, and operates at arms length from 
Ministers.  Advisory NDPBs are generally set up 
to provide independent expert advice to Ministers 
and their departments on matters within their sphere of interest.

LDAP has been set up to advise the Secretary of 
State for Culture, Media and Sport on the content 
and timing of regulations for implementing the 
Legal Deposit Libraries Act 2003 with reference 
to the deposit of particular classes of non-print 
media.  Three sub-groups have been established to 
take forward particular aspects of the Panel’s 
work.  The Panel meets three or four times a year 
with the sub groups meeting and taking forward work in between Panel meetings.
